Maiduguri Floods: Tinubu orders creation of Disaster Relief Fund

Following the recent flood disaster in Borno State, President Bola Tinubu on Monday directed the creation of a Disaster Relief Fund.

Minister of Finance and Coordinating Minister for the Economy, Wale Edun made the disclosure while briefing the media on the outcome of Monday’s Federal Executive Council meeting.

He said since disasters such as the Maiduguri flooding will likely become a regular occurrence because of climatic changes, it is imperative to create specialised kind of funding to meet emerging demands and challenges associated with the phenomenon.

Recall that the Maiduguri flooding was an unprecedented disaster that submerged half of the city, killing some citizens and destroying critical infrastructure.

Edun noted that the Federal Government will do all in its powers to mobilise funding from critical stakeholders for the Disaster Relief Fund.
